<small date-time="b8l_ie"></small><bdo draggable="kyt189"></bdo><u lang="7advm4"></u><i date-time="lrwmaz"></i><area id="m48prh"></area><strong date-time="kgbhyr"></strong>

TPWallet 子钱包创建与运维全指南:高效确认、前沿技术与权限审计实践

本文面向开发者与运维工程师,系统介绍在 TPWallet 中创建与管理子钱包的流程,并覆盖高效交易确认、前沿科技应用、行业变化分析、信息化创新趋势、测试网实践与权限审计要点。

一、子钱包与总体架构概述

1. 什么是子钱包:在 HD(分层确定性)或账户抽象架构下,子钱包表示由主种子派生出的独立账户或链上控制单元,便于多链管理、权限隔离与业务场景划分。

2. TPWallet 架构要点:通常包含主种子/助记词、安全存储(本地加密或硬件)、派生策略(derivation path)、子钱包元数据与权限模块。

二、在 TPWallet 中创建子钱包:逐步操作与建议

步骤一:初始化主钱包

- 生成或导入主助记词,建议使用 BIP39/BIP44 兼容方式,并立即备份助记词。

- 为主种子启用强加密(设备级或 keystore),并绑定设备认证要素(PIN/生物/硬件)。

步骤二:新增子钱包

- 在应用或 SDK 中选择新增账户/子钱包,指定链类型(例如以太、BSC、Solana 等)、派生路径与命名。

- 选择签名模式:单签、多签(M-of-N)、阈值多方计算(MPC)或社交恢复等。

- 配置限额与白名单(如每日限额、目标地址白名单),便于权限控制。

步骤三:备份与导出策略

- 对每个创建的子钱包生成元信息备份(派生路径、索引、账户别名、权限配置),但不要导出私钥到不受信任的环境。

- 对于多签或 MPC,保存参与方公钥、策略描述与密钥备份流程文档。

步骤四:上线与验证

- 在测试网完成交易发送与签名流程验证,确认签名兼容性、nonce 管理与手续费估算正确。

- 启用审计日志、交易通知与异常告警。

三、高效交易确认策略(提升确认速度与可靠性)

- 智能费用估算:结合链上费率 oracle 与短期预测模型,动态调整手续费以在目标确认时间窗内成功打包。

- 批量化与打包:合并多笔相似目的的转账或使用合约批量发送以节省 gas 并提升吞吐。

- Replace-By-Fee / Speed-up:支持重放替换或加速交易的 re-broadcast 策略,配合 nonce 管理。

- Layer2 与状态通道:对高频、低价值交易使用 Rollup、Plasma 或状态通道以快速确认并降低主网压力。

- 预签名与延迟广播:在权限可控场景下预签若干交易并在后续按需广播以减少用户等待时间。

四、前沿科技在子钱包中的应用

- 多方阈值签名(MPC):通过分布式私钥签名降低单点私钥泄露风险,可实现去托管或托管+非托管混合方案。

- 可验证延展性技术(zk 技术):在隐私计算、批量交易证明和轻客户端验证中提升效率与隐私。

- 安全执行环境(TEE)与硬件安全模块(HSM):用于私钥签名与密钥隔离,提高抗攻击能力。

- 账户抽象与智能合约钱包:将策略(每日限额、黑白名单、多重验证)上链为合约逻辑,支持更灵活的权限控制。

- 自动化合规引擎与链上/链下联合风控:基于图谱分析、地址威胁评分与实时规则链路阻断可疑交易。

五、行业变化分析与影响

- 多链并存与跨链互操作增多,钱包需要支持更多派生路径与跨链桥接安全性方案。

- 合规与监管趋严,托管型钱包与企业级钱包需增加 KYC/AML 审查、可审计流水和合规报告能力。

- 用户对隐私与自主管理的需求并存,促使钱包提供多种托管模式(自托管、多签、托管)并兼顾 UX。

六、信息化创新趋势

- 钱包即平台:提供钱包 SDK、插件市场、自动化策略引擎与可视化运维面板。

- 可编排的权限策略:以策略语言描述权限规则,支持热加载与安全回滚。

- 数据化运维:链上/链下指标采集、交易成功率、确认时间 P90/P99 指标用于自动调优。

七、测试网与上链验证实践

- 使用公开测试网模拟链上行为,结合私有沙箱(local node)进行深度压力测试与故障演练。

- 自动化测试用例包括:助记词恢复、派生路径兼容性、并发签名、nonce 冲突场景与异常网络条件下的重试策略。

- 建议使用模拟器与混合测试环境(fork 主网)进行回放式验证以检测与主网一致性问题。

八、权限审计与合规实施要点

- 最小权限原则:按角色分配最小必要权限,并使用时间/额度限制降低风险窗口。

- 审计日志:记录关键操作(子钱包创建、权限变更、交易签名、密钥备份)并保证日志不可篡改(如写入可验证存证或使用 WORM 存储)。

- 独立审计与渗透测试:定期邀请第三方安全机构对签名流程、密钥管理、合约钱包逻辑及 API 进行审计。

- 访问控制与多因子验证:结合硬件签名器、MFA 与基于策略的人机验证流程。

- 智能合约权限模块:在合约钱包中实现可升级权限模块并对升级操作设多重确认与冷备份。

九、总结与实践建议

- 设计阶段就考虑可审计性与权限分离,选择合适的签名模式(单签、多签、MPC)并充分测试。

- 在上线前通过测试网、回放与压力测试验证所有异常路径,建立自动报警与快速回滚机制。

- 关注行业前沿技术(MPC、zk、账户抽象)并评估其在业务场景中的成本效益与安全收益。

附:快速创建子钱包示例流程(伪步骤)

1. 初始化主种子并备份。

2. 在 TPWallet 中选择 新建 子钱包 -> 选择链 -> 指定派生路径 -> 选择签名策略。

3. 配置权限(白名单、限额) -> 启用审计日志 -> 在测试网验证交易签名与确认。

4. 上线并开启监控、定期审计。

通过上述方法,TPWallet 的子钱包既能满足业务灵活性,也能兼顾高效交易确认与安全合规。

作者:林墨发布时间:2026-03-04 19:06:41

评论

AlexChen

写得很实用,尤其是关于 MPC 和测试网的部分,受教了。

小白量子

步骤清晰,权限审计那段对我公司落地很有帮助。

DevLily

建议再补充一些常见错误案例和恢复流程,会更完备。

安全先生

关于审计日志的不可篡改建议非常关键,值得推广。

相关阅读
<dfn lang="ni7rwy"></dfn><em dropzone="hfu1vg"></em><abbr id="9wyuf2"></abbr><tt dropzone="j8qq_r"></tt><noframes id="6je9e8">